1. Guest, as per the stickied thread, this forum has not been in use since 2014. All bugs and feature requests should be posted to JIRA.

Repetitive crashing

Discussion in 'Bugs & Feature Requests' started by MaxwellTheCoder, Jun 6, 2017.

  1. Hello, I have a spigot/bukkit server. I have this Repetitive crashing whenever I start my server. I use putty to run my server, not on my computer. When it crashes, it says this:

    [21:34:13 INFO]: [EssentialsAntiBuild] Disabling EssentialsAntiBuild vTeamCity
    [21:34:13 INFO]: [EssentialsGeoIP] Disabling EssentialsGeoIP vTeamCity
    [21:34:13 INFO]: [Duels] Disabling Duels v2.2.3
    [21:34:13 INFO]: [EssentialsSpawn] Disabling EssentialsSpawn vTeamCity
    [21:34:13 INFO]: [Magic] Disabling Magic v6.8
    [21:34:13 INFO]: [EssentialsProtect] Disabling EssentialsProtect vTeamCity
    [21:34:13 INFO]: [SimplePrefix] Disabling SimplePrefix v2.5.1
    [21:34:13 INFO]: [EssentialsXMPP] Disabling EssentialsXMPP vTeamCity
    [21:34:13 INFO]: [Fe] Disabling Fe v0.8.3
    [21:34:13 INFO]: [Fe] Vault support disabled.
    [21:34:13 INFO]: [Essentials] Disabling Essentials vTeamCity
    [21:34:13 INFO]: [Vault][Economy] Essentials Economy unhooked.
    [21:34:14 INFO]: [OITCRecoding] Disabling OITCRecoding v5.2.8
    [21:34:14 INFO]: [WorldGuard] Disabling WorldGuard v6.1.3-SNAPSHOT;c904242
    [21:34:14 INFO]: [WorldGuard] Shutting down executor and waiting for any pending tasks...
    [21:34:14 INFO]: [Multiverse-Core] Disabling Multiverse-Core v2.5-b719
    [21:34:15 INFO]: [Vault] Disabling Vault v1.5.6-b49
    [21:34:15 INFO]: [BetterChairs] Disabling BetterChairs v0.9.0
    [21:34:15 INFO]: [Vehicles] Disabling Vehicles v8.2
    [21:34:15 INFO]: [WorldEdit] Disabling WorldEdit v6.1;no_git_id
    [21:34:15 INFO]: [BukkitPhones] Disabling BukkitPhones v1.0
    [21:34:15 ERROR]: Error occurred while disabling BukkitPhones v1.0 (Is it up to date?)
    java.lang.NullPointerException
    at com.bwfcwalshy.bukkitphones.Main.onDisable(Main.java:49) ~[?:?]
    at org.bukkit.plugin.java.JavaPlugin.setEnabled(JavaPlugin.java:273)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.bukkit.plugin.java.JavaPluginLoader.disablePlugin(JavaPluginLoader.java:361) [sp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.bukkit.plugin.SimplePluginManager.disablePlugin(SimplePluginManager.java:424) [sp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.bukkit.plugin.SimplePluginManager.disablePlugins(SimplePluginManager.java:417) [sp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.bukkit.craftbukkit.v1_11_R1.CraftServer.disablePlugins(CraftServer.java:345) [sp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at net.minecraft.server.v1_11_R1.MinecraftServer.stop(MinecraftServer.java:464) [sp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at net.minecraft.server.v1_11_R1.MinecraftServer.run(MinecraftServer.java:612) [sp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at java.lang.Thread.run(Thread.java:745) [?:1.7.0_80]
    [21:34:15 INFO]: [MultiWorld] Disabling MultiWorld v5.2.8
    [21:34:15 INFO]: [MultiWorld] Disabled.
    [21:34:15 INFO]: Saving players
    [21:34:15 INFO]: Saving worlds
    [21:34:15 INFO]: Saving chunks for level 'world1'/Overworld
    [21:34:25 INFO]: Saving chunks for level 'world1_the_end'/The End
    [21:34:25 INFO]: Saving chunks for level 'Arcade'/Overworld
    [21:34:25 INFO]: Saving chunks for level 'City'/Overworld
    [21:34:25 INFO]: Saving chunks for level 'DuelMatch'/Overworld
    [21:34:25 INFO]: Saving chunks for level 'FreeBuild'/Overworld
    [21:34:25 INFO]: Saving chunks for level 'GreetLobby'/Overworld
    [21:34:25 INFO]: Saving chunks for level 'HideAndSeek'/Overworld
    [21:34:25 INFO]: Saving chunks for level 'HideSeek'/Overworld
    [21:34:25 INFO]: Saving chunks for level 'Hogcraft'/Overworld
    [21:34:26 INFO]: Saving chunks for level 'Hogcraft_backup'/Overworld
    [21:34:26 INFO]: Saving chunks for level 'Hogwarts'/Overworld
    [21:34:26 INFO]: Saving chunks for level 'HorseSpleef'/Overworld
    [21:34:26 INFO]: Saving chunks for level 'Lobby'/Overworld
    [21:34:27 INFO]: Saving chunks for level 'MainLobby'/Overworld
    [21:34:27 INFO]: Saving chunks for level 'OITC'/Overworld
    [21:34:27 INFO]: Saving chunks for level 'Skywars'/Overworld
    [21:34:27 INFO]: Saving chunks for level 'SpawnLobby'/Overworld
    [21:34:27 INFO]: Saving chunks for level 'dog'/Overworld
    [21:34:27 INFO]: Saving chunks for level 'test'/Overworld
    [21:34:27 INFO]: Saving chunks for level 'world'/Overworld
    [21:34:28 INFO]: Saving chunks for level 'world1_nether'/Nether
    [21:34:28 INFO]: Saving chunks for level 'world_backup'/Overworld
    [21:34:28 INFO]: Saving chunks for level 'world_nether'/Nether
    [21:34:28 INFO]: Saving chunks for level 'world_the_end'/The End




    Is there any way I can fix this? I saw something like this in 2014 from a video that spigot and bukkit won't work because of copy write and they disable the downloads. This is a really awesome server and I would be really appreciative if it can be done as soon as possible. And should I use the Patch thing that they introduced in 2014? Please help me.
     
  2. its because of "BukkitPhones"
     
  3. electronicboy

    IRC Staff

    that likely isn't the issue. If you want help, you should post the *full* log file on something like hastebin.
    Also, Buildtools is the proper way to obtain spigot(or if you really wanna be outdated, craftbukkit)
     
  4. I used Buildtools, and buildtools2, still not working
     
  5. I found something new now:

    java.lang.OutOfMemoryError: GC overhead limit exceeded
    at java.util.Arrays.copyOfRange(Arrays.java:2694) ~[?:1.7.0_80]
    at java.lang.String.<init>(String.java:203) ~[?:1.7.0_80]
    at java.lang.StringBuilder.toString(StringBuilder.java:405) ~[?:1.7.0_80]
    at sun.reflect.generics.parser.SignatureParser.parseIdentifier(SignatureParser.java:268) ~[?:1.7.0_80]
    at sun.reflect.generics.parser.SignatureParser.parsePackageNameAndSimpleClassTypeSignature(SignatureParser.java:338) ~[?:1.7.0_80]
    at sun.reflect.generics.parser.SignatureParser.parseClassTypeSignature(SignatureParser.java:312) ~[?:1.7.0_80]
    at sun.reflect.generics.parser.SignatureParser.parseFieldTypeSignature(SignatureParser.java:291) ~[?:1.7.0_80]
    at sun.reflect.generics.parser.SignatureParser.parseFieldTypeSignature(SignatureParser.java:285) ~[?:1.7.0_80]
    at sun.reflect.generics.parser.SignatureParser.parseTypeSignature(SignatureParser.java:487) ~[?:1.7.0_80]
    at sun.reflect.generics.parser.SignatureParser.parseTypeSig(SignatureParser.java:190) ~[?:1.7.0_80]
    at sun.reflect.annotation.AnnotationParser.parseSig(AnnotationParser.java:429) ~[?:1.7.0_80]
    at sun.reflect.annotation.AnnotationParser.parseAnnotation2(AnnotationParser.java:238) ~[?:1.7.0_80]
    at sun.reflect.annotation.AnnotationParser.parseAnnotations2(AnnotationParser.java:117) ~[?:1.7.0_80]
    at sun.reflect.annotation.AnnotationParser.parseAnnotations(AnnotationParser.java:70) ~[?:1.7.0_80]
    at java.lang.reflect.Field.declaredAnnotations(Field.java:1128) ~[?:1.7.0_80]
    at java.lang.reflect.Field.getAnnotation(Field.java:1114) ~[?:1.7.0_80]
    at me.main__.util.multiverse.SerializationConfig.SerializationConfig.serialize(SerializationConfig.java:308) ~[?:?]
    at org.bukkit.configuration.file.YamlRepresenter$RepresentConfigurationSerializable.representData(YamlRepresenter.java:33)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.yaml.snakeyaml.representer.BaseRepresenter.representData(BaseRepresenter.java:94)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.yaml.snakeyaml.representer.BaseRepresenter.representMapping(BaseRepresenter.java:156)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.yaml.snakeyaml.representer.SafeRepresenter$RepresentMap.representData(SafeRepresenter.java:306)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.bukkit.configuration.file.YamlRepresenter$RepresentConfigurationSection.representData(YamlRepresenter.java:23)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.yaml.snakeyaml.representer.BaseRepresenter.representData(BaseRepresenter.java:94)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.yaml.snakeyaml.representer.BaseRepresenter.representMapping(BaseRepresenter.java:156)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.yaml.snakeyaml.representer.SafeRepresenter$RepresentMap.representData(SafeRepresenter.java:306)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.yaml.snakeyaml.representer.BaseRepresenter.representData(BaseRepresenter.java:94)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.yaml.snakeyaml.representer.BaseRepresenter.represent(BaseRepresenter.java:64)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.yaml.snakeyaml.Yaml.dumpAll(Yaml.java:242)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.yaml.snakeyaml.Yaml.dumpAll(Yaml.java:206)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.yaml.snakeyaml.Yaml.dump(Yaml.java:181)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.bukkit.configuration.file.YamlConfiguration.saveToString(YamlConfiguration.java:39)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at org.bukkit.configuration.file.FileConfiguration.save(FileConfiguration.java:68)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    [02:53:23 INFO]: [EssentialsProtect] Disabling EssentialsProtect vTeamCity
    [02:53:23 INFO]: [MultiWorld] Disabling MultiWorld v5.2.8
    [02:53:23 INFO]: [MultiWorld] Disabled.
    [02:53:23 INFO]: Saving players
    [02:53:23 INFO]: GamerBoy793 lost connection: Server closed
    [02:53:23 INFO]: GamerBoy793 left the game
    [02:53:23 INFO]: Saving worlds
    [02:53:23 INFO]: Saving chunks for level 'world'/Overworld
    [02:53:31 ERROR]: Failed to save chunk
    net.minecraft.server.v1_11_R1.ReportedException: Saving entity NBT
    at net.minecraft.server.v1_11_R1.Entity.e(Entity.java:1475)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at net.minecraft.server.v1_11_R1.Entity.d(Entity.java:1358)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at net.minecraft.server.v1_11_R1.ChunkRegionLoader.a(ChunkRegionLoader.java:316)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at net.minecraft.server.v1_11_R1.ChunkRegionLoader.a(ChunkRegionLoader.java:142) [sp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at net.minecraft.server.v1_11_R1.ChunkProviderServer.saveChunk(ChunkProviderServer.java:209) [sp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at net.minecraft.server.v1_11_R1.ChunkProviderServer.a(ChunkProviderServer.java:232) [sp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at net.minecraft.server.v1_11_R1.WorldServer.save(WorldServer.java:1005) [sp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at net.minecraft.server.v1_11_R1.MinecraftServer.saveChunks(MinecraftServer.java:439) [sp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at net.minecraft.server.v1_11_R1.MinecraftServer.stop(MinecraftServer.java:493) [sp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at net.minecraft.server.v1_11_R1.MinecraftServer.run(MinecraftServer.java:612) [sp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at java.lang.Thread.run(Thread.java:745) [?:1.7.0_80]
    Caused by: java.lang.OutOfMemoryError: GC overhead limit exceeded
    at net.minecraft.server.v1_11_R1.EntityInsentient.b(EntityInsentient.java:336)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    at net.minecraft.server.v1_11_R1.Entity.e(Entity.java:1450) ~[spigot-1.11.2.jar:git-Spigot-d4f98a3-cb61ac0]
    ... 10 more
    [02:53:34 ERROR]: Exception stopping the server
    java.lang.OutOfMemoryError: GC overhead limit exceeded
    [02:53:36 WARN]: Exception in thread "Thread-1"
    [02:53:37 WARN]: java.lang.OutOfMemoryError: GC overhead limit exceeded




    So I can't install anything else now?
    I might have somebody else help me and it might work, and I can tell you for the future if I found out
     
  6. java.lang.OutOfMemoryError: GC overhead limit exceeded

    Your server requires too much power compared to the resource it has. How many maps are there? How much plugin is there? And what plugins are installed on the server?

    --

    Ton serveur demande trop de puissance par rapport au ressource dont il dispose. Combien y'a t'il de map ? Combien y'a t'il de plugin ? Et quels sont les plugins install├ęs sur le serveur ?
     
  7. [02:53:37 WARN]: java.lang.OutOfMemoryError: GC overhead limit exceeded

    Its the point, maybe one of you plugins leak the memory or can you start your server with more ram?
     
  8. There are about 9 maps, and I brought the plugins down to about 9 and it still won't work
     
  9. And the plugins I have are quite trusted, maybe it leaked more over time
     
  10. electronicboy

    IRC Staff

    GC Overhead means that your server is getting to the point where GC is triggering in a way that it's judged that it cannot free up enough ram to stop itself from crashing.
    That generally means that you've not allocated enough memory to java, or, if it only happens after long running sessions, a memory leak.
    there is a flag to disable that system, but it's generally not a good idea to have that enabled otherwise you're likely to have major performance issues.

    "Trusted" means nothing in this community, even some of the plugins that people highly rate have major issues.